Health
(Including HIV and AIDS, Water and Sanitation)
What ADRA is doing…
ADRA's health programs are designed to address local indicators of health, including infant mortality, under-age five mortality, maternal mortality, access to health-care services, safe water and sanitation, immunisation, percentage of malnutrition, and average life expectancy.
Most often, ADRA's health programs focus on activities such as improving access to clean, potable water and sanitation systems. ADRA oftentimes partners with local communities to provide materials and technical expertise to enable communities to construct gravity-fed and water well systems. Community members are also taught how to use as well as maintain the water system to ensure sustainability.
ADRA also believes it is critical to respond to the increase in HIV and AIDS in many countries and incorporates AIDS awareness education in most health-related projects.
ADRA is meeting health needs through HIV and AIDS awareness education programs in Papua New Guinea, Vietnam, and Cambodia; Tobacco-Free Youth programs in Vietnam, Mongolia and Cambodia; and the development of a specialised health training curriculum for Indigenous people in Australia.
